So here's the low down of how I'm setting out my December daily: it will be in the album I have used for 2015, I am using a variety of page protectors, bits from the Simple Stories Claus&co collection as well as pulling things from my own stash.
So far I have created "foundation pages" and title cards for each day. My aim is to take at least one photo per day and have even written down ideas for photos so that way I know if all else fails I've got ideas to fall back on.
Some ideas, that may work for you;
1 - Decorations, this could be your tree at home, at work or even the lights on the house that always puts your lonely string of lights around the window to shame.
2 - Wrapping presents (bonus points if you include a piece of the wrapping paper you use in your album), I make an evening of it, music and sellotape at the ready and I'm set to face the wrapping.
3 - Candles, nothing beats a scented candle, so snap a few of your favourite scents - also good for remembering the name of them when you need to rebuy them.
4 - Blankets, what's winter without huge soft blankets to wrap up?! Favourite movies, for me it has to be the Santa Claus movies, 1, 2 and 3.
5- Sparkles, let's face if you ever need an excuse to wear sequins it's Christmas or you can just take pictures of the sparkle that's created when the sun hits ice or frost.
6 - Traditions, our family tradition would be 4pm Christmas Eve mass followed by a Chinese takeaway and movies or games, random but almost like a calm before the storm.
